Locally we have our hands full with the Detroit City Council.  In fact, when I chose to write about other topics, just to give everyone a break from the predictable behavior of the Council, I was accused of backing away from the issue.   Our Detroit City Council, unfortunately, makes national news.   Then we have our list of governors from Rod Blogijevich, to Eliot Spitzer, and not to be outdone by the Democrats, Republican Governor Mark Sanford.   The scandals may vary from prostitutes, to bribes and throw in a little “bad judgment” in men’s bathrooms, and finally adultery, it makes for interesting reading over your cornflakes.  

I am not judging what a person chooses to do in their personal life, but when it becomes public knowledge the news attention, including the public apologies, and Larry King therapeutic sessions, are we not missing the real point?   There are public servants who work hard, devote themselves to important issues and author policy that should be more important than the name of the prostitute or undercover police officer in a sting.
